Man City in talks with clubs over Nwakali

Manchester City are in talks with five different clubs over the transfer of former Nigeria U20 international Chidiebere Nwakali.

The central midfielder has entered the final twelve months of his contract with the Premier League champions and wants to leave the club on a permanent basis instead of being loaned out for the sixth time in his City career.

It is understood that Manchester City agreed to the demands of Chidiebere Nwakali and his representatives, paving the way for him to join a new employer before the close of the summer transfer window, and are now locked in talks with interested clubs.

Chidiebere Nwakali is now represented by English-based Stellar Group, who brokered the deal that took his brother Kelechi to Arsenal in 2016.

Since officially becoming a player of City in 2015, he has been loaned out to Málaga B, Girona, IK Start, Sogndal and Aberdeen due to work permit issues.

The 21-year-old trained with the Nigeria National Team ahead of their final World Cup qualifier against Algeria and traveled with the team to Russia for a friendly against Argentina last November.
